Disassembling Flip Video USB Port

      • Turn off the device and take the batteries out.

      • Remove metal sticker under the LCD screen with a spudger.

      • This may require a large force to pry off the glued sticker.

      • Remove the 4 gray screw caps with the spudger. These cover the screw heads and protect from dirt or grime.

      • Remove the 5 10mm screws with the #00 Phillips screwdriver. These connect the back of the outer shell to the front of the outer shell.

      • Open battery door. This can be done by gently depressing and sliding the battery down downward.

      • Use the spudger to separate outer shells.

      • The spudger must be inserted between the shell halves to pry the edges apart.

      • Slowly work around the outside to separate the halves.

      • Remove the 3 5mm screws securing the circuit board to the front shell with the #00 Phillips screwdriver.

      • Slowly lift the left side of the circuit board.

      • Do not attempt to remove the circuit board completely yet. It is still connected to the device.

      • Disconnect the USB port cable from the back side of the circuit board.

      • Slide out the battery contacts.

      • Remove black 3mm screw that secures wire to outer shell with #00 Phillips screwdriver.

      • Lift wire out of the outer shell slot.

      • The wire mount should stay attached to the wire.

      • Use tweezers to remove the spring that holds the port door shut.

      • Make sure the spring is firmly grasped by the tweezers so that it does not shoot off of the case.

      • Remove the 3 screws securing USB port cover to the outer case with the #00 Phillips screwdriver.

      • Remove the USB port cover.

      • Remove the USB slider.

      • Lift out the USB port slowly.

      • Since the hinge is spring loaded, be careful that no pieces fall out when the port is lifted.

To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
